Gallery 46

Gallery 46 is a Londonewcastle project space run in association with Martin J Tickner, Sean McLusky and Fruitmachine founders, Martin Bell and Wai Jung Young. The venue continues the legacy of Tickner and Mclusky’s previous gallery, MEN on Redchurch Street Shoreditch London.

Housed in a pair of renovated Georgian houses in the grounds of Whitechapel Hospital and set over three floors and eight rooms, Gallery 46 is a kaleidoscopic addition to Whitechapel’s burgeoning gallery scene and its artistic heart, the nearby Whitechapel Gallery. Since it opened in October 2016, the gallery has hosted works by artists such as Iain Sinclair and Eley Kishimoto, as well as successful exhibitions such as their first show, Autonomy.
